Picking the right reference track for your mix is super important. Here’s how you can do it:
Match the Genre: Find a song that fits the same style as your music. For example, if you’re working on a pop song, check out the top pop songs out there.
Look for Good Quality: Choose a song that sounds really good, made by a professional artist or producer. This way, you have a strong example to compare your mix to.
Similar Sounds: Think about songs that use the same types of instruments and have a similar layout. If your song has a lot of synthesizers, look for tracks that use those too.
By looking at these things, you’ll make your mixing skills a lot better!
